Adnoc Supply & Services has signed an agreement with Jiangnan Shipyard in China to build four new LNG carriers, each with a capacity of 175,000 cubic meters, at a value of up to $900 million, with delivery expected in 2029. This investment aims to strengthen the company's fleet and increase its capacity to meet the growing global demand for natural gas, bringing the total number of its new carriers to 18. It also seeks to ensure revenue sustainability through long-term contracts. This initiative is part of Adnoc’s strategy to enhance its ability to transport gas efficiently and support the global energy market.
